When negatively charged colloids like As2S3 sol is added to positively charged Fe(OH)3 sol in suitable amounts

A
Both the sols are precipitated simultaneously
B
This process is called mutual coagulation.
C
They become positively charged colloids.
D
They become negatively charged colloids.

The correct answer is:
CHECK THE SOLUTION.

(a, b)

Positive and negative sol will precipitate each other.
